MODIFY ! ! !

There is very little in the VW to be commended outside of the diesel engine.

Electrics that rival Lucas for reliability.

I have removed, changed, discarded, modified, almost everything on my 87
jettaTD, back windows no longer work, front doors replaced with manual
winder types, A/C long gone,
switches and leds on dash permitting continuing motion regardless of what
fails in the relay box.

The under carriage seems fairly reliable, with 2 year brake replacement
intervals, front wheel bearings from time to time, but I would mount it on
casters with a single drive wheel to keep it going.

Now close to 500,000km and still drives like a sports car.

Regretably, the lower frame channels are disolving from the outside in. I
wonder if injecting them with urea foam would slow this down?

Bore a big hole at each end, blow warm air through for a day to dry it, then
pack with foam-in-place urea. Might be structurally strong enough to hold it
together after the steel has gone away.
